Are you passionate about supporting older people to live independently in their own homes? Look no further!

Our team of dedicated staff is committed to making a positive impact in the lives of older people.

As a member of our team, you will not only assist with everyday domestic tasks like housework, shopping, meal preparation, and laundry, but also provide friendly social visits and accompany clients on outings and appointments. The role means supporting people to live as independently as possible in their own homes, including clients with dementia. You'll be fully supported by the office-based Help@Home team.

A varied role, you'll need to have your own transport and be confident to visit different locations all over the borough of Kingston upon Thames
